新聞中心
越來越多的企業(yè)都在構建安全可靠的分布式緩存系統(tǒng),以滿足瞬變的流量需求。Redis在一組節(jié)點之間構成集群,通過復制保證數據安全,能夠保證單臺節(jié)點故障時,服務能正常運行。

為崇州等地區(qū)用戶提供了全套網頁設計制作服務,及崇州網站建設行業(yè)解決方案。主營業(yè)務為成都網站制作、做網站、崇州網站設計,以傳統(tǒng)方式定制建設網站,并提供域名空間備案等一條龍服務,秉承以專業(yè)、用心的態(tài)度為用戶提供真誠的服務。我們深信只要達到每一位用戶的要求,就會得到認可,從而選擇與我們長期合作。這樣,我們也可以走得更遠!
在Redis集群單臺故障時,集群會自動地消極進行重新分片。即在故障的節(jié)點上的數據會轉移到可用節(jié)點上,而客戶端SDK重新組裝哈希環(huán)即可使用。
要進行故障檢測。一般在構建Redis集群時,會添加定時任務監(jiān)控集群每個節(jié)點的運行狀態(tài),一旦有臺節(jié)點故障,系統(tǒng)會及時發(fā)現。
然后,客戶端SDK要進行故障切換。SDK重新請求從節(jié)點列表,重新組裝哈希環(huán)后,可以正常對Redis集群進行使用。具體實現步驟如下:
1.定時獲取節(jié)點列表
2.拓撲排序,組裝哈希環(huán)
3.根據哈希環(huán),路由數據請求
除此之外,要保持Redis集群的可用,還可以采用錯誤檢測及熔斷機制,來降低錯誤引入系統(tǒng)中的風險。當發(fā)生錯誤時,首先要進行必要的檢測,如對受攻擊服務器IP進行檢測,例如匹配ip地址策略。若檢測結果符合預期,熔斷機制可以暫時將其它服務器的請求拒絕,以此保證數據安全。
以上就是Redis集群單臺故障時,如何保證系統(tǒng)的可用的方法。通過定時的故障檢測及SDK的故障切換,以及采用正確的檢測及熔斷機制,系統(tǒng)可以得到有效的保護,保證服務的正常訪問。
創(chuàng)新互聯(lián)服務器托管擁有成都T3+級標準機房資源,具備完善的安防設施、三線及BGP網絡接入帶寬達10T,機柜接入千兆交換機,能夠有效保證服務器托管業(yè)務安全、可靠、穩(wěn)定、高效運行;創(chuàng)新互聯(lián)專注于成都服務器托管租用十余年,得到成都等地區(qū)行業(yè)客戶的一致認可。
分享題目:失效Redis集群單臺故障如何保持系統(tǒng)可用(redis集群單數臺)
網頁URL:http://www.5511xx.com/article/dhpecpc.html


咨詢
建站咨詢
